What made Hackett the choice for the Broncos?​

Nick Kosmider, Broncos beat writer: Energy and offense are good places to start.



The Broncos were looking for a dynamic leader in the wake of Fangio's firing. Hackett checks that box as a coach whose presence in front of a locker room has drawn rave reviews from Rodgers down to former Syracuse players who Hackett coached during his first stint as an offensive coordinator 12 years ago. He also helped orchestrate an offense in Green Bay that ranked fifth in scoring and second in offensive EPA during his three seasons as coordinator.

During Hackett’s stint with the Packers, Rodgers played some of the best football of his career. As a team that has languished near the bottom of the league in numerous offensive categories during its five-year playoff drought, Denver is hoping Hackett's vision on that side of the ball can maximize the considerable talent on the roster.
